Output f68a23a0f94d94a3c48613fcb19708a1bc3f05f2ff2c1202db2256dfac34337c:0

value
4044454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fffb0f55a53693abf6d362fd2d78ed1d285d38b OP_EQUAL
address
3BuDEaMvmHXrYr77ZfprZ3KnGwq9xYdjz3
transaction
f68a23a0f94d94a3c48613fcb19708a1bc3f05f2ff2c1202db2256dfac34337c
confirmations
184417
spent
true